The American Rescue Plan Act of 2021 (ARP) provides billions of dollars to local governments through Fiscal Recovery Funds (FRF), competitive grants and other provisions to help meet community housing needs. In this podcast, Baker Tilly’s public sector housing leaders share insights on the financial opportunities municipalities have to support housing. In 20 minutes, we discuss:
- The federal funding available for housing as a result of the pandemic and how communities receive funds
- What communities with housing needs can do with their ARP FRF allocations
- How municipalities are applying ARP funds to affordable housing projects
- Types of housing that federal financial assistance can support
- The appropriated emergency funding available to communities for housing
- How grant funding can be used to advance housing initiatives
- Additional legislation on the horizon within the Infrastructure Bill and Build Back Better Plan to further support housing
